The CNG compressor industry is experiencing robust growth, driven by the global transition toward cleaner, low-emission fuels and the increasing adoption of natural gas vehicles (NGVs). As governments and industries prioritize sustainable transportation, the demand for reliable compressed natural gas (CNG) infrastructure has surged, directly boosting the need for advanced compressor systems.
Industry growth is fueled by several key factors. The rising adoption of public transportation buses, commercial trucks, and delivery fleets running on CNG has created a consistent demand for high-pressure, energy-efficient compressors. Additionally, industrial applications requiring natural gas for operations, along with the expansion of private and fleet refueling stations, are contributing to market growth.
Technological innovation is another significant driver. Modern CNG compressors now feature variable-speed drives, automated monitoring systems, leak detection, and predictive maintenance capabilities, improving efficiency and reliability while reducing operational costs. Small-scale and portable compressors are gaining popularity, enabling flexible deployment for urban, remote, and mobile fueling setups, further supporting industry expansion.
Regional growth trends indicate that Asia-Pacific leads the market due to rapid urbanization, government incentives for NGVs, and increasing environmental regulations. North America and Europe continue to grow steadily, driven by the modernization of existing CNG infrastructure and commitments to reduce greenhouse gas emissions. Emerging markets in the Middle East, Latin America, and Africa are expected to offer new growth opportunities as CNG adoption rises.
